Leaked Report Criticizes UK Defense Programs

Sunday, August 23, 2009

According to an August 24 report from The Guardian, the UK government was urged to publish an official 296-page report by Bernard Gray, a former senior Ministry of Defence adviser, warning of “lethal" weakness in government programs. The report complained that it takes 20 years to buy a ship, or aircraft, or tank and seems to cost at least twice what was thought.
